Chinese Chicken & Mango Salad

Nice light meal. The salad in this recipe was really yummy. The chicken was good too, but could of used a bit more flavour. If I made this again, I'd probably marinade the chicken in 2t honey, 2T vinegar, 4T soya, 5 spice & garlic for an hour before cooking.

Time=0
Chicken
2t sesame oil
8 drumsticks
In a big pot, quickly brown chicken in really hot seasame oil.
Add:
½ c chicken stock
2t honey
2t white wine vinegar
2T Soya sauce
1t Chinese 5 spice powder
6 cloves garlic (crushed)
½c water
Bring to the boil then simmer for 20mins or until chicken is cooked. You'll probably need to turn the pieces during cooking.
Time=30
Remove chicken to rest, throw in
1½c Mung Beans
Place beans on plate and arrange chicken on top.

Time=15
Mango salad
1 mango sliced thinly
2 spring onions chopped
½c chopped corriander (loosley packed)
100g snow peas (toped & tailed)
½ cucmber (sliced)
Cut all into sticks and assemble on plate. Squeeze over fresh
lime
